INTRODUCTION
Employee engagement is defined as the concept of human resource that describes the
level of dedication and enthusiasm of workers towards their job. Engaged employees perform
determined task with efficiency and contribute in attaining determined task in best possible
manner as well as reduce the absenteeism (Schroeder and Modaff, 2018). In this report chosen
organisation is Marks and Spencer which is founded in 1884 and headquarter situated in London,
England, UK. Organisation deals in clothing, home and food products. This report covers the
employee engagement programmes that are conducted by the organisation for reduce the level of
absenteeism of employees and improve their engagement level. Along with that positive and
negative factors of employee engagement are discussed in this project report.
MAIN BODY
Employee engagement
Employee engagement programme or activities are defined as the mechanism that is used
by the organisations define and priorities their actions for the purpose of improving employee
engagement. To improve employee engagement, various programmes are conducted by the
Marks & Spencer that make employees feel comfortable and improve their working
performance. Respective organisation analyses the major drivers like career growth, wellness &
balance, clear mission and purpose, benefits and compensation, recognition and rewards and
leadership that plays important role in employees happiness and satisfaction.
